The Volvo EX60 is a midsize electric SUV on the new SPA3 platform with an 800-volt architecture and a native NACS charging port. US buyers can choose a 369 hp rear-drive P6, a 503 hp all-wheel-drive P10, or a 670 hp all-wheel-drive P12, with EPA range from roughly 307 to 400 miles (494 to 644 km). A well-equipped P6 Plus starts at $58,400.

The Volvo EX90 is a full-size, seven-seat electric flagship SUV built on the SPA2 platform. US buyers can choose between a 329 hp Single Motor, a 442 hp Twin Motor, and a 670 hp Twin Motor Performance, with EPA range up to 305 miles. For 2026 the range adds a Black Edition appearance package with gloss-black trim and 22-inch wheels.
The Volvo XC40 is a compact SUV sold exclusively with mild-hybrid petrol power in Europe, with the fully electric version now badged separately as the EX40. UK buyers choose between a 163 hp B3 and a 197 hp B4, both front-wheel drive, across Core, Plus, Plus Pro, Ultra and Black Edition trims from £35,840.

Volvo global sales fell 8 percent in the first half of 2026 to 324,800 cars, but CEO Hakan Samuelsson says the company's most ambitious product plan yet is set to turn that around, starting with the new EX60 electric SUV and a record-demand EX90 flagship, with a strategy reveal and electric successors to the S60 and V60 due later this year.
Volvo has extended its Black Edition treatment to the EX90, the brand's flagship electric SUV. Nothing changes mechanically: the package is gloss-black exterior and interior trim, offered across all three powertrains and, for the first time, with paint colors other than black.

Volvo was founded in 1927 in Gothenburg, Sweden, and built its reputation on safety engineering, introducing innovations such as the three-point seatbelt in 1959 and sharing the patent freely across the industry. The company passed through Ford ownership from 1999 to 2010 before Chinese conglomerate Geely Holding acquired it, funding a broader model range and a shift toward electrification.
The current lineup spans SUVs (XC40, XC60, XC90), sedans and estates (S90, V60, V90), and a growing family of electric vehicles built on dedicated EV platforms, including the EX30, EX40, EX60 and flagship EX90. Volvo also holds a controlling stake in Polestar, the standalone electric performance brand it co-owns with Geely.
Production is split between Sweden, Belgium, China and a US plant in Ridgeville, South Carolina, giving Volvo manufacturing access across its three largest markets.
